Many of the island's best sights are handily nearby, with Victoria, the capital, just 3km up the road and the soaring prehistoric temples of Ggantija a little way across the farmland. Xaghra is also where you'll find Xerri's Grotto, a private house with an amazing set of underground caves located underneath featuring beautiful stalactites, and stalagmites. Virtually untouched by tourism, this gem of an island north of Malta is only 14km long and 7km wide and is no brash tourist resort - just open country sides and a wonderful calm atmosphere. Here you will find plenty of fascinating sights, from the mighty Citadel of Victoria the capital, to the colourful harbour of Mgarr and Megalithic temples of Ggantija, Xaghra. The Gozitan simple life style centers around farming and fishing, with tourism only beginning to make an impact around the fishing port of Marsalforn. Farmers still use the hoe and scythe to work their terraced hillside and commute home to hill top villages by donkey cart.
The ancient temples of Ggantija dating back to 4000B.C. Victoria - the capital and the massive Citadel built by the Knights of St John. Natural wonders such as the Inland Sea at Dwejra and Calypso's Cave with its' wonderful view of Ramla Bay.
Excellent swimming, snorkeling and scuba diving.
